Runbook: Account Recovery — Glimmerbar Consent Banner Rollout

If a user got locked out mid-rollout (the banner sometimes eats the session token — yes, still), don't just reset them. Check whether their consent record landed in the Glimmerbar staging ledger first, then trigger the recovery flow from the admin panel. The flow will prompt for the team recovery passphrase, which is listed just below.

vault phrase of tajef-tafog = istox-sorax-zorox-casok-holox-kelix-weneth-drueth-casion

Ticket: PROCTOR-4412

The Quillgate exam-proctoring queue in staging is pulling zero jobs because the worker was deployed with the production env template. Sessions pile up and candidates see endless spinners. Copy the staging template into the worker's env file, then append the following line so the queue consumer can authenticate.

sealed setting: ARCHIVE_KEY3=8d0

Subject: Move to Annual Billing

Team — Nordquay Software will transition eligible accounts to annual billing next quarter. Sales leads should flag contracts with mid-cycle renewal clauses to Brenna Holt before outreach begins. Discount authority remains unchanged during the transition. The commercial reasoning behind this shift is captured in the confidential note below.

board note of yaduf-hahip: Only 5 of the 80 pilot accounts renewed Ulaath, so a churn review is set for April 1.